Output dffef59e88721af18c827930b2e88c779cb2a41eec6534afd821acc4f559907e:0

value
187663476
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89a267820d1b9fdbc2fed2b0aad7c711eb8a8473 OP_EQUALVERIFY OP_CHECKSIG
address
1DYk8LDXtazn53tMAFfhtXM7Kr7EqLnxFV
transaction
dffef59e88721af18c827930b2e88c779cb2a41eec6534afd821acc4f559907e
spent
true